Is it normal to experience anxiety before an exam? Yes, it is absolutely normal to experience anxiety before an exam. In fact, it's a common reaction that many students face. This feeling of unease or nervousness is often referred to as "test anxiety" or "exam stress." Let's delve into this topic further: Understanding Exam Anxiety Exam anxiety can manifest in various ways, such as physical symptoms like sweating, trembling hands, or a racing heartbeat. Mental symptoms like difficulty concentrating or thinking negatively about the exam are also common. Emotional symptoms like feeling overwhelmed or fearful may also occur. Why Does It Happen? Several factors can contribute to exam anxiety, including performance pressure, lack of preparation, past experiences, and perfectionism. Coping with Exam Anxiety There are several strategies to manage exam anxiety effectively, such as adequate preparation, relaxation techniques, positive self-talk, time management, and maintaining a healthy lifestyle. Seeking Support If your anxiety is severe or persistent, consider seeking support from tutoring, study groups, or professional help. Final Thoughts Remember, it's okay to feel anxious before an exam. Acknowledge your feelings without judgment and utilize the strategies mentioned above to manage your anxiety. With preparation and the right mindset, you can approach your exams with confidence and competence.
Marie Curie's life and work epitomize scientific breakthrough and personal resilience. Born in a restricted society, she overcame numerous obstacles to become the first woman to win a Nobel Prize and the only person to win in two different sciences. Her pioneering research on radioactivity led to advancements in physics, chemistry, medicine, and technology. Despite facing significant gender bias, Marie's dedication and achievements have made her a timeless inspiration for scientists worldwide.

Managing Test Anxiety: Strategies for Success Test anxiety is a common issue faced by many students, especially during exams. It can have a negative impact on performance and overall well-being. However, there are specific exercises that can help in dealing with test anxiety. In this article, we will discuss some effective strategies for managing test anxiety. Mindfulness meditation is a powerful tool for reducing stress and anxiety. By focusing on the present moment and observing thoughts without judgment, you can learn to calm your mind and reduce feelings of anxiety. Deep breathing exercises can help to slow down your heart rate and relax your muscles, reducing feelings of anxiety. Visualization techniques involve imagining yourself successfully completing a task or achieving a goal. This can help to build confidence and reduce anxiety. Cognitive restructuring involves identifying and challenging negative thoughts that contribute to anxiety. By replacing these thoughts with more realistic and positive ones, you can reduce feelings of anxiety. In conclusion, test anxiety is a common issue faced by many students, but there are specific exercises that can help in dealing with it. Mindfulness meditation, deep breathing exercises, visualization techniques, and cognitive restructuring are all effective strategies for managing test anxiety. By practicing these exercises regularly, you can reduce feelings of anxiety and improve your performance on exams.

Teaching reading comprehension to young children is essential for their educational development. Here are strategies for making this process engaging and effective: 1. Start with short, simple texts like picture books, nursery rhymes, or short stories that are age-appropriate and interesting. 2. Make reading interactive by asking questions before, during, and after reading to encourage critical thinking. 3. Encourage vocabulary building by highlighting unfamiliar words and discussing their meanings. 4. Incorporate writing activities such as story maps, character sketches, and sequencing to reinforce comprehension skills. 5. Make learning fun by using games, drama, and music related to the text. Adapt your approach based on the child's interests and abilities to ensure maximum engagement and success.

To make food photos stand out on social media, focus on good lighting, composition, styling, angles, post-processing, captioning, and audience engagement. Natural light is preferred, harsh shadows should be avoided, and the rule of thirds applied for better composition. Styling can involve using complementary props and colors, while experimenting with different shooting angles adds variety. Post-processing should be subtle and consistent. Captions should tell a story, and relevant hashtags used. Engaging with your audience helps build community.
Taking photos with a smartphone has become increasingly popular, but to make your photos stand out, you can try some creative techniques and ideas. Here are some ways to take unique and interesting photos using your smartphone: 1. Use different perspectives such as bird's eye view, worm's eye view, and Dutch angle. 2. Experiment with lighting techniques like golden hour, long exposure, and backlighting. 3. Play with color by using monochrome mode, color splash, and cross-processing. 4. Tell a story through sequence shots, composites, and captions. 5. Get closer to your subject by taking macro shots, portraits, and details. 6. Use natural frames like architecture, nature, and reflections. 7. Embrace movement by using panning, motion blur, and freeze action techniques. 8. Create symmetry and patterns through symmetrical compositions, repeating patterns, and grids. 9. Make it personal by taking selfies, handheld objects, and personal stories. 10. Use post-production magic like editing apps, special effects, and creative cropping.

Sports documentaries and fictional sports films differ in audience reception due to their distinct approaches to storytelling, emotional impact, and overall purpose. Sports documentaries focus on real-life stories, providing an authentic portrayal of athletes, teams, and events, while fictional sports films prioritize entertainment value, often incorporating drama, comedy, or romance elements alongside sports action. Documentaries typically follow a linear narrative structure, focusing on a specific timeline or event, while fictional films often feature complex plot twists and character arcs that add depth to the story. Both genres have their merits and can leave lasting impressions on audiences in different ways.
